      Application

      I applied online.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at Secondmind (Cambridge, England) in Jan 2019

      Interview

      An initial phone interview to assess viability, followed by a take home coding challenge (4-8hours) and finally an in person interview. The in person interview lasts most of a day. You must do a presentation on something relevant to start (approx 45mins), followed by a few separate one-on-one interviews which cover a few areas (for example, one is a whiteboard based technical interview if you apply for an engineering role). Lots of work needed (code challenge plus interview presentation) is the downside. Presentations bias for more extroverted types. One on one's were good though; much nicer than sitting opposite a few people at once.
